This has worked well in Natty, but in Oneiric, this no longer works properly. I'll provide the steps I followed: 1) clean install of Oneiric 64bit from October 2nd. (I've used several others too with the same results) 2) set up wireless. No problems. 3) select the wired interface in nm-connection-editor, edit and Method: shared with other computers in the IPv4 page. What happens is that the network is configured and works, but only for a few seconds. Then the network goes into a loop of connect/disconnect. I can use the shared connection on the desktop to a certain degree, but it becomes extremely slow and things like IRC cannot be used since the connection is dropped every two seconds or so. If I boot a Natty live session, this works perfectly using the exact same settings. I will attach my syslog.
